Item 01-08: MSU Bike Trail Proposal Mr. Dan Williams advised the commission that he and Mr. Clark are requesting the commission's suggestions and ultimately their support for the Sikes Lake Pedestrian and Bicycle Trail project that is being considered for funding. Mr. Williams provided a map of the proposed trail and addressed the safety issues that have been addressed in the project. The trail will be lighted and offers amenities for the public. The one area of concern was noted at the entrance to the trail on Taft Blvd. Mr. Williams requested flashing warning lights and signs to notify traffic of pedestrian crossings. The commission voiced their concerns due to the fact that pedestrian crossings offer a false security to pedestrians and can prove to be hazardous in themselves. Different possibilities Page 2 were discussed to alleviate the safety concerns. The commission suggested that the trail end at Taft Blvd. rather than extending across the street. The public will then not be encouraged to cross the street at that point rather than-crossing at the intersection as they would under normal circumstances. Mr. Williams agreed they would take a closer look at that area and make adjustments. The commission voted to send a letter of recommendation and support in favor of the project. The commission agreed that the project fits beautifully with the city trail project and will certainly be an enhancement for the community. Item closed.
